Global Transcatheter Tricuspid Valve Repair Market Report to 2032

The global transcatheter tricuspid valve repair market was valued at $1.4 billion in 2025. It is expected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.1%, reaching $2.1 billion by 2032.

Market Overview

The global transcatheter tricuspid valve repair market includes devices used to reduce tricuspid regurgitation through minimally invasive catheter-based approaches. These technologies are designed to treat patients who may not be suitable candidates for open surgical repair.

Tricuspid regurgitation is common among elderly patients and patients with heart failure, but it has historically been underdiagnosed and undertreated. This has created a large clinical gap and a significant opportunity for transcatheter repair technologies.

Among the four heart valve repair markets, the tricuspid valve repair segment has recently gained significant attention from major manufacturers. This interest is being driven by the large unmet clinical need and expanding indications for minimally invasive treatment.

Abbott and Edwards Lifesciences are expected to continue investing heavily in product development, clinical research, and geographic expansion over the forecast period. This investment is expected to accelerate innovation and adoption within the TTVr market.

Market Drivers

Large Underserved Patient Population

Tricuspid regurgitation represents a large underserved patient population. The condition is highly prevalent, particularly among elderly patients and patients with heart failure.

Historically, TR has often been underdiagnosed and undertreated. Many patients were not referred for treatment until late in disease progression, while others were managed conservatively because surgical treatment carried significant risk.

The development of transcatheter treatment options is expanding the addressable patient pool. By offering a less invasive approach for patients who may not tolerate open surgery, TTVr devices are expected to support meaningful procedure growth through 2032.

Shift Toward Minimally Invasive Therapies

Broader cardiovascular trends continue to favor less invasive procedures over open-heart surgery, especially among high-risk patients. TTVr procedures are performed percutaneously, avoiding sternotomy and cardiopulmonary bypass.

This aligns with both patient and provider preferences. Patients may benefit from reduced procedural trauma, shorter recovery times, and lower surgical burden compared to traditional open procedures.

As hospitals continue to build structural heart programs, minimally invasive tricuspid repair is expected to gain greater attention. This trend supports adoption of TTVr technologies across major cardiac centers and specialized treatment programs.

Increasing Awareness and Diagnosis of TR

Increasing awareness and diagnosis of tricuspid regurgitation are key drivers of the TTVr market. Improvements in imaging, screening, and clinical awareness are helping physicians identify significant TR earlier.

Earlier diagnosis expands the pool of patients eligible for repair. It also allows physicians to identify patients before disease progresses too far, which may improve treatment suitability.

As awareness increases among cardiologists, structural heart teams, and referring physicians, more patients are expected to enter the treatment pathway. This will support procedure growth and increase demand for TTVr devices.

Market Limiters

Limited Physician Experience

Physician experience with TTVr remains limited compared to transcatheter mitral or aortic procedures. This creates a learning curve for patient selection, device handling, imaging support, and procedural success.

Because TTVr is still developing, many centers do not yet have the same level of operator experience that exists in more mature structural heart markets. This can slow adoption, even when patient demand is present.

Training will be important to market growth. Until more physicians and treatment centers gain experience with TTVr procedures, procedure volumes may increase more gradually than the size of the patient pool would suggest.

Diagnosis and Referral Gaps

Diagnosis and referral gaps remain important barriers in the TTVr market. Tricuspid regurgitation is often overlooked because symptoms can overlap with other cardiac conditions.

Patients may present with signs related to heart failure or other cardiovascular disease, making it difficult to isolate TR as the main treatment target. As a result, some patients are referred only after disease has progressed significantly.

Late referrals can reduce eligibility for repair. If the condition is too advanced, patients may no longer be suitable candidates for certain TTVr procedures. This limits the treatable population and constrains market growth.

Reimbursement Uncertainty

Reimbursement uncertainty is another key market limiter. While initial reimbursement pathways exist following TriClip's FDA approval, coding and coverage are still evolving.

Inconsistent or limited reimbursement may delay adoption in some hospital systems. Hospitals must evaluate whether TTVr procedures are supported by clear payment pathways and whether the economic benefits justify investment.

Until reimbursement becomes more predictable, some centers may be cautious about expanding TTVr programs. This is especially important in regions where hospital budgets and payer coverage policies are more restrictive.

Competitive Analysis

Abbott was the leading competitor in the global TTVr device market in 2025, holding a majority market share. The company's TTVr system is TriClip, the first dedicated transcatheter tricuspid TEER system designed specifically for treating tricuspid regurgitation.

Abbott is expected to maintain its market leadership over the forecast period. Its position is supported by continued investment in tricuspid valve treatment technologies, strong structural heart experience, and early leadership in dedicated tricuspid repair.

Edwards Lifesciences was the second-largest competitor in the TTVr market in 2025. The company's PASCAL System is a minimally invasive transcatheter repair platform indicated for treating tricuspid regurgitation in patients at high surgical risk.

The PASCAL Precision system received CE Mark approval in 2022 for both mitral and tricuspid repair, establishing Edwards Lifesciences as a key competitor to Abbott's TriClip system. As part of Edwards' broader transcatheter edge-to-edge repair portfolio, PASCAL supports the company's position in the expanding structural heart market.

P&F Products & Features was the third-largest competitor in 2025 through its TricValve(R) Transcatheter Bicaval Valve System. The TricValve system uses self-expanding biological valves implanted in the superior and inferior vena cava to reduce symptoms associated with severe TR without direct intervention on the native tricuspid valve. The technology has CE Mark approval and is available in select international markets.

Technology and Practice Trends

Transcatheter Edge-to-Edge Repair

Transcatheter edge-to-edge repair is a central technology trend in the TTVr market. These systems are designed to reduce tricuspid regurgitation by improving leaflet coaptation through a catheter-based approach.

This technique avoids open surgery and supports treatment of high-risk patients.

Dedicated Tricuspid Repair Systems

Dedicated tricuspid repair systems are gaining importance as the market becomes more focused on TR-specific anatomy and treatment needs.

Abbott's TriClip is an example of a dedicated tricuspid TEER system designed specifically for the treatment of tricuspid regurgitation.

Bicaval Valve Technologies

Bicaval valve technologies offer another approach to treating severe TR. These systems do not directly repair the native tricuspid valve but instead use valves placed in the vena cava to reduce symptoms.

P&F Products & Features' TricValve system is an example of this approach.

Growing Structural Heart Investment

Major manufacturers are investing more heavily in tricuspid valve treatment. Product development, clinical research, and geographic expansion are expected to remain important over the forecast period.

This investment should support innovation, physician training, and broader adoption.

Earlier Diagnosis

Better imaging and screening are improving the detection of significant tricuspid regurgitation. Earlier diagnosis may expand the pool of patients eligible for repair and improve treatment timing.

This trend is important because late referrals can reduce the number of patients who remain suitable for repair.

Reimbursement Development

Reimbursement pathways are still evolving in the TTVr market. Clearer coding, coverage, and payment structures will be important for broader hospital adoption.

As reimbursement becomes more predictable, more centers may be willing to expand TTVr programs.
